Bruce

This handsome OES is 1-year old, Bruce, who joined his furever home on Aug 18th, 2024. Bruce (originally Cosmo) was found with his brother, Bandit, abandoned in a parking lot in El Paso, TX. RROESR had both boys picked up and they were fostered with an amazing family in Duncanville, until Bruce’s family was able to meet with them and take Bruce home! Bruce now has an older Sheepadoodle brother, Flynn. From the very first introduction, they knew that Bruce and Flynn would be the best of buds. They do everything together: play, sleep & eat and are pretty inseparable. And oh so cute when they play!

 

Bruce is goofy, adorable and loving and boy does he LOVE treats! He knows the second he hears a bag crinkling open and runs over. He is also obsessed with playing fetch and getting ice cubes as a reward on a hot day. Bruce enjoys the little things in life but he does NOT like squirrels and is always trying to chase them down (oops!) He also isn't a fan of people walking by the house (stranger danger), and barks to let his family know when there is anyone around. (smart boy!) But, Bruce's biggest dislike of all is being left at home for a couple of hours when his humans need to go out because he wants to be where ever they are at all times!

 

Bruce’s family shared that he loves sleeping in with the whole family and waking everyone up with sloppy kisses. He also loves to go outside in the morning to check everything out, then come back in for a nap because apparently that’s exhausting! Bruce pretty much cuddles up and naps all day while his humans get some work done. He loves to go to the park, take long walks (to chase the silly squirrels), and spend as much time with his humans and brother as possible.

 

Bruce has adapted well to his new home in Plano, TX and is thriving. He loves to snuggle, follows you everywhere (for protection!), and always has a smile on his face and light in his eyes. When his family first adopted Bruce, he was a little shy in his new home and it took a little bit for him to get used to their routine. Once he realized he was in his furever home, he quickly adjusted and became the most loving, sweet, caring, and adorable dog. He's perfect for his family and home, and loves every stranger he meets! All of his families friends are so obsessed with Bruce and his sweet and kind demeanor. (We can’t say we blame them!) Bruce’s family feels so lucky to have found him, and they know he feels lucky too!

 

Bruce’s family also shared that he has absolutely changed their lives and home. They are forever grateful to RROESR for introducing them to best pup they could have ever asked for. Each day Bruce shows his family how happy and loved he is, and they keep showing him our unconditional love back. We’ll end with a funny story: One day while Bruce’s human dad was out of town, his Mom was calling Bruce's name and couldn't find him in the house at all. She started frantically searching outside and in every room. She made it to the back where the primary bedroom was and captured the funniest picture. Bruce had buried himself behind all of the decorative pillows on the bed and looked so confused as to why he was being bothered during his comfy nap. It was the perfect example of his silly and loving personality. (What a ham!) Bruce’s family couldn't love him anymore and we couldn’t love this love story anymore!
